words
spill out the mouth
the
unbidden mists
veiled
un-truths
half-verities
for
one moment
I
am whole
but
it is not me
some
other woman
echoes
through the hollow openings
gaping
wide between truth and trust
instead an embrace
I
plunge into silent darkness
cold
arms close over me
and
I am stolen
pirated
time's
bewitched cargo
